Enabling the Stand-Alone Synchronizer
A mobile user can control the synchronization start-up process by running the Siebel Remote client in a third-party scheduling program. Table 13 shows the command-line options for the Siebel Remote client.
NOTE: If a local connection to the client is open and the user uses the Siebel Remote icon to synchronize, synchronization works successfully. However, if a new database extract exists for that user, the synchronization fails, because it is trying to overwrite the sse_data.dbf file, which is already in use. Therefore, the stand-alone Siebel Remote client should only be used when the mobile Web client is not in use.
Table 13. Stand-Alone Synchronizer Command-Line Options Option Definition Required/Optional Default Value and Usage Notes /n Client name Required Name of mobile Web client. The value must be entered using uppercase letters. /u User name Required Database connection user name. The value must be entered using uppercase letters. /p User password Required Database connection password. The value must be entered using uppercase letters. /p2 Confirmation password Required Required when initializing. /c Configuration file Required The default is siebel.cfg. /d Data source Optional The default is local. /a Autostart mode Optional Available modes are Y or N. /v Verbose mode Optional Available modes are Y or N.1 /i Iterations Optional Sets the number of iterations. /l Language Optional Language to use for the docking session. /sleep Sleep time Optional Number of seconds to sleep between iterations. /comm Communication parameters Optional Used for modem connections. /RecvFiles Receive files Optional Determines whether mobile Web client will download files from server. Available modes are Y or N. /RecvTxns Receive transactions Optional Determines whether mobile Web client will download transactions from server. Available modes are Y or N. /SendTxns Send transactions Optional Determines whether mobile Web client will send transactions to server. Available modes are Y or N. /RecvPubFiles Receive published files Optional Determines whether mobile Web client will download published files. Available modes are Y or N. /RecvAutoUpdFiles Receive auto updates to files Optional Determines whether mobile Web client will download updates to requested files. Available modes are Y or N. /?
/help Help Optional Provides online help for usage.
1You may want to run the Stand-Alone Synchronizer unattended by setting the verbose mode to N. After synchronization, the Stand-Alone Synchronizer returns 0 if the process succeeded, or a nonzero Siebel error code if it failed.
